腾讯云
开发者社区
文档
建议反馈
控制台
登录/注册
首页
学习
活动
专区
工具
TVP
最新优惠活动
文章/答案/技术大牛
搜索
搜索
关闭
发布
精选内容/技术社群/优惠产品,
尽在小程序
立即前往
文章
问答
(9999+)
视频
沙龙
1
回答
Linux
内核如何处理异步I/O (AIO)请求?
、
、
、
、
我正在尝试
Linux
(我指的是
Linux
,即linuxaio.h提供的函数,如
io
_submit(...)等,而不是POSIX )。我注意到
Linux
比使用同时带有O_DIRECT标志的同步
IO
要快得多。最让我惊讶的是,使用
Linux
对几个KBs进行多个小随机读取所获得的
吞吐量
非常高,甚至比使用同步I/O和O_DIRECT对少数MBs进行大(顺序)读取的
吞吐量
还要高。所以,我想知道:为什么
Linux
比同步I/O更
浏览 1
提问于2015-03-12
得票数 20
回答已采纳
2
回答
Linux
上的磁盘
IO
模拟器
、
、
、
、
我想测试数据库性能,并了解数据库
吞吐量
(以每秒事务数表示)如何依赖于磁盘属性,如
IO
延迟和变化、写入队列长度等。理想情况下,我需要一个模拟器,它可以作为磁盘卷挂载,并将RAM磁盘封装到控制器中,允许在延迟、
吞吐量
、稳定性等方面设置所需的
IO
配置文件。我想知道
Linux
是否有这样的模拟器,或者用C语言编写它的最佳方式是什么?
浏览 1
提问于2014-06-20
得票数 1
3
回答
IO
阻塞的进程是否会在“top”输出中显示100%的CPU利用率?
、
、
、
预计
IO
和CPU都是密集型的(如果有人对此感兴趣,那就是非常高的
吞吐量
和短读DNA对齐)。问题是如何确定使总
吞吐量
最大化的最佳进程数量。在某些情况下,进程可能会成为
IO
绑定的进程,因此添加更多进程将没有好处,甚至可能是有害的。 我能从标准的系统监视工具中看出什么时候达到了那个点吗?top (或者其他工具)的输出可以让我区分
IO
绑定进程和CPU绑定进程吗?我怀疑
IO
上阻塞的进程可能仍显示100%的CPU利用率。
浏览 0
提问于2010-12-30
得票数 4
回答已采纳
1
回答
有可能迫使TCP窗口缩放到更高的值吗?
、
、
是否可以在
Linux
上增加TCP窗口缩放因子(CentOS 7.2)?我想使用缩放因子,看看我的
吞吐量
是否发生了变化。 我的延迟是88 ms往返。我之所以这样问是因为使用UDP时,我的速率超过了90 Mbps,所以我想,如果可以的话,最好能将我的TCP
吞吐量
提高一倍。Wireshark显示,我从Windows到
Linux
的sftp确实在使用TCP窗口缩放,所以我知道在我的路径中支持它。否则,我将
查看
我的LFN的TCP多径(http://www.multipath-tcp.org
浏览 0
提问于2016-05-23
得票数 5
回答已采纳
1
回答
单独的CPU和
IO
时间
、
、
、
我有一个具有大量
IO
的应用程序。此应用程序是多线程的,只有一个专门用于
IO
请求的线程,因此在某些情况下,
IO
和CPU会重叠。我想知道中央处理器做了多少有用的工作。例如,如果我们做了一个完美的RAID系统,我们可能能够显著减少(如果不能消除)
IO
因素。之后,我们会受到主存和CPU
吞吐量
的限制。我怎么知道呢?我如何衡量这一点? 谢谢鲍勃
浏览 2
提问于2011-06-13
得票数 4
1
回答
如何在测试期间分析磁盘
io
,然后创建FIO模型?
对于
linux
(rhel/centos)系统,是否有一种方法可以在主动测试期间收集/分析系统的磁盘
io
(iops、读取
吞吐量
、写入
吞吐量
等),并将其转换为FIO类型的模型/作业文件(柔性
IO
测试工具:https://github.com/axboe/fio ),以便直接对磁盘
io
场景进行可重复测试?这将用于以可重复的方式直接测试磁盘
io
子系统,而不依赖于重新运行用于创建模型/配置文件的原
浏览 0
提问于2017-08-04
得票数 0
回答已采纳
2
回答
获取磁盘
吞吐量
的
Linux
命令
我想知道我的
linux
机器的磁盘i/o等待,磁盘
吞吐量
指标。有没有什么
Linux
命令可以获取磁盘
吞吐量
?请帮帮我。
浏览 9
提问于2018-01-10
得票数 0
3
回答
吞吐量
= BS * IOPS?
、
、
我在许多地方看到
吞吐量
= bs * iops应该是真的。例如,将128 k的块大小写入可以支持190IOPS的SAS磁盘,应该提供大约23 MBps - 23.75(MBs) = 128(BS)*190(SAS-15 IOPS)/1024的
吞吐量
。zero of=/tmp/dd.out bs=4k count=2097152为了
查看
VM的
IO
率,我使用了iosta
浏览 0
提问于2012-04-15
得票数 2
1
回答
是什么限制了客户VM中virtio网络接口的
吞吐量
?
、
、
、
假设一个具有KVM的
Linux
主机运行带有virtio接口的
Linux
客户VM,那么限制virtio接口
吞吐量
的因素是什么?尽管带宽可能是1 Gbps,因为它是一个虚拟接口,但我假设数据
吞吐量
可以更高。
吞吐量
是否受来宾VM的CPU的限制,或者在此之前会有virtio驱动程序的限制?
浏览 3
提问于2014-04-21
得票数 1
回答已采纳
1
回答
Linux
机器上的SD卡
吞吐量
、
、
、
我试图在嵌入式
Linux
平台(
Linux
4.1)上运行一个自定义应用程序。这个应用程序连续地将1MB的数据写入SD卡(Sandisk类)。应用程序使用fwrite()调用将数据写入SD卡。下面是我在监视SD卡写入
吞吐量
时的观察结果。 SD卡规范表示支持的最低
吞吐量
为10 MBps。为什么瞬时<
浏览 5
提问于2015-12-11
得票数 0
7
回答
Linux
下的低延时串行通信
、
、
、
、
我正在
Linux
的串口上实现一个协议。该协议基于请求应答方案,因此
吞吐量
受到将数据包发送到设备并获得应答所需时间的限制。这些设备大多是基于arm的,运行
Linux
>= 3.0。哪些
IO
接口的延迟最低: select、poll、epoll或使用ioctl手动轮询?阻塞或非阻塞
IO
是否会影响延迟? 我尝试使用setserial设置low_latency标志。
浏览 3
提问于2012-10-30
得票数 16
回答已采纳
1
回答
性能测试期间的NodeJS空闲操作
、
、
、
、
相对于nodejs,这里试图解决新构建的应用程序中的性能问题。以下是我们从j量表中看到的图表之一(尽管服务器没有挂起) 通过加载CPU配置文件,我们在Chrome绘制了火焰图。我本来希望在这一点上发现JS卡在某个地方,但我发现正是在这个时间范围内,节点服务器被闲置了很长一段时间。有人能帮助我理解在被客户端请求轰炸时
浏览 1
提问于2016-08-25
得票数 1
1
回答
EC2 r3.8xLargeEBS存储限制
、
我们有一个r3.8xLargeSQL 2014实例。我们已经在这个实例中附加了两个EBS卷(每个5TB)。对于一个EC2可以附加多少个EBS卷或总的EBS存储限制(例如不超过15 TB或一些最佳做法)是否有限制?谢谢。
浏览 0
提问于2018-04-18
得票数 0
1
回答
如何理解为什么UDP只以相对较慢的速率接受数据包?
、
、
、
、
我使用Windows上的Interix将我的C++
Linux
应用程序更容易地移植到Windows。我的应用程序通过套接字向运行
Linux
的机器发送和接收数据包。在发送时,我只获得大约180 KB/秒的
吞吐量
,而当接收到时,我的
吞吐量
大约为525 KB/秒。在
Linux
上运行的相同代码接近每秒2500 KB。我觉得我应该能够在发送超过180 KB/秒时获得更好的
吞吐量
,但不知道如何确定丢失数据包的原因是什么。 为了提高
吞吐量
,我该如何着手研
浏览 1
提问于2013-06-02
得票数 3
回答已采纳
2
回答
验证
IO
瓶颈
、
在
Linux
中,如何验证
IO
吞吐量
(就磁盘、总线或网络而言)是否饱和,以使我的团队相信问题在于在不同的物理主机上进行虚拟化而不是虚拟化?
浏览 0
提问于2016-10-10
得票数 3
4
回答
如何将代码推送到尽可能多的CPU资源上?
、
、
、
我启动了jvisualvm和htop来
查看
cpu和内存是如何工作的。我可以看到有3个线程在运行,cpu核心也很忙。但是这些内核的使用率很少超过50%。
浏览 0
提问于2013-01-18
得票数 1
1
回答
测量流量生成器的
吞吐量
、
、
如何测量基于软件的流量生成器的
吞吐量
?我正在尝试测量软件生成器在1Gbps网卡上生成流量的速率。
浏览 4
提问于2012-09-22
得票数 0
2
回答
带有RAID的数据库上的
Linux
IO
调度程序
、
、
、
我有一个6磁盘RAID 10的
linux
数据库(MySQL)服务器(戴尔2950),默认的
IO
调度程序是CFQ。主要关注的是减少CPU使用和提高
吞吐量
。此外,我还看到了对数据库使用noop/deadline
IO
调度器的建议,主要是因为数据库的R/W访问的性质。
浏览 0
提问于2010-04-16
得票数 3
1
回答
为什么“`select *”的
io
吞吐量
比本地磁盘中使用拼图箭头的“选择一个colmun`”快
、
、
、
、
* from table`, total_data_size = 45GB我添加了
io
吞吐量
的配置文件(是的,删除页面缓存,只看磁盘-
io
)。通过iostat**:** ,我想有两个原因 当执行utils=90%~100%时,
io
负载较高(约100~130
io
/s,sql2 ),这意味着select one column更多地使用randread,从而使
io
浏览 8
提问于2022-10-10
得票数 0
2
回答
linux
中TCP实现的动态调整
In在
linux
内核(3.4及以上版本)中实现的动态右尺寸(DRS)--内核2.4.23和2.4.8的链接(http://public.lanl.gov/radiant/software/drs.html
浏览 0
提问于2014-10-30
得票数 0
点击加载更多
扫码
添加站长 进交流群
领取专属
10元无门槛券
手把手带您无忧上云
相关
资讯
【linux】如何查看服务器磁盘IO性能
Linux查看日志
存储大师班 | Linux IO 模式之 io_uring
Linux下查看CPU信息
Linux 查看 SELinux 的状态
热门
标签
更多标签
云服务器
ICP备案
对象存储
腾讯会议
云直播
活动推荐
运营活动
广告
关闭
领券